Position: Safety Inspector - (Saudi National)

Job Description

Parsons are looking for Safety Inspector - Saudi National to be part of our team. The Safety Inspector will be responsible for ensuring compliance with safety regulations, policies, and procedures during night shifts on a construction project. The role involves monitoring site activities, identifying potential hazards, and implementing corrective measures to maintain a safe working environment for all personnel.

What You’ll Be Doing
  • Conduct regular inspections of the construction site during night shifts to identify unsafe conditions, practices, or equipment.
  • Ensure compliance with safety standards, regulations, and company policies.
  • Proactively identify potential hazards and recommend corrective actions to prevent accidents or injuries.
  • Monitor high-risk activities such as heavy equipment operation, electrical work, and elevated tasks.
  • Investigate and document any incidents, near-misses, or unsafe conditions observed during the shift.
  • Prepare detailed reports and communicate findings to the project management team.
  • Conduct safety briefings and toolbox talks for night shift workers.
  • Promote awareness of safety protocols and emergency procedures.
  • Act as the first point of contact for emergencies during the night shift.
  • Coordinate with relevant teams to ensure timely response to incidents.
  • Verify that workers are using app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E).
  • Ensure adherence to site-specific safety guidelines and local regulations.
  • Maintain accurate records of safety inspections, incidents, and corrective actions taken.
  • Submit daily safety reports to the project management team.
What Required Skills You’ll Bring
  • Diploma or degree in Occupational Health and Safety, Engineering, or a related field.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ience as a Safety Inspector, preferably in construction projects.
  • OSHA, NEBOSH, or equivalent safety certifications.
  • Strong knowledge of construction safety standards and regulations.
  • Excellent observation and analytical skills.
  • Effective communication and reporting abilities.
  • Ability to work independently during night shifts.
  • Night shift role with working hours from 01:00 AM to 10:00 AM, including a 1-hour break.
  • Physically demanding environment requires frequent movement across the construction site.
  • Exposure to outdoor conditions and construction-related hazards.
